GNU social JP
  • FAQ
  • Login
GNU social JPは日本のGNU socialサーバーです。
Usage/ToS/admin/test/Pleroma FE
  • Public

    • Public
    • Network
    • Groups
    • Featured
    • Popular
    • People

Conversation

Notices

  1. Embed this notice
    のえる (noellabo@fedibird.com)'s status on Tuesday, 26-Nov-2024 16:34:10 JST のえる のえる
    • かき@GNUsocialJP

    現行のPleroma / Akkomaに、プロフィール補足情報(Misskeyだと追加情報)が多すぎるとアカウント情報の取得に失敗し、再取得を繰り返してしまうバグが存在します。

    これにより、CPUが使い尽くされたり、データベースが肥大したり、相手サーバへ過大な負荷をかけてしまいます。

    Pleroma / Akkoma全体でこれが発生するため、実質的にDDoSを仕掛けるような挙動となります。

    デフォルトが20なので、これを設定(Instance の Max remote account fields)で大きく引き上げる方法でまず対応し、

    指定数をオーバーしたら切り捨てて対応するパッチをあてる対応が必要です。
    https://git.pleroma.social/pleroma/pleroma/-/merge_requests/4220

    Pleroma / Akkomaの新バージョンがリリースされたら速やかにアップデートしましょう。

    この不具合は、プロフィール補足情報の件数が多いActivityPub実装すべてで発生します。

    Mastodonの標準は4件、Misskeyは16件、Fedibirdは8件ですが、独自に数を増やしているサーバであれば該当する可能性があります。

    また、Misskey.ioのバナー機能はプロフィール補足情報で連合するので、こちらでも発生します。

    In conversation about 6 months ago from fedibird.com permalink

    Attachments



    1. https://s3.fedibird.com/media_attachments/files/113/548/045/945/040/406/original/a9d27069aee7f440.png
    • ピッカマンV likes this.
    • Embed this notice
      のえる (noellabo@fedibird.com)'s status on Tuesday, 26-Nov-2024 19:46:48 JST のえる のえる
      in reply to
      • かき@GNUsocialJP

      Akkomaについて、今回の不具合への対応を含む不定期リリースが出ています。3.13.3です。
      https://akkoma.dev/AkkomaGang/akkoma/src/branch/develop/CHANGELOG.md#3-13-3

      stableブランチだね。
      QT: https://ihatebeinga.live/objects/7dcc6cd6-3918-435e-bc95-571f70b28345 [参照]

      In conversation about 6 months ago permalink

      Attachments


      1. Domain not in remote thumbnail source whitelist: akkoma.dev
        akkoma/CHANGELOG.md at develop
        from AkkomaGang
        akkoma - Magically expressive social media
    • Embed this notice
      のえる (noellabo@fedibird.com)'s status on Wednesday, 27-Nov-2024 01:01:00 JST のえる のえる
      in reply to
      • かき@GNUsocialJP

      Pleromaについても修正出てますね。2.7.1。
      https://git.pleroma.social/pleroma/pleroma/-/blob/mergeback/2.7.1/CHANGELOG.md
      QT: https://queer.hacktivis.me/objects/0c18522d-f19a-4408-92b2-8cb4091e4cb6 [参照]

      In conversation about 6 months ago permalink

      Attachments

      1. Domain not in remote thumbnail source whitelist: git.pleroma.social
        CHANGELOG.md · mergeback/2.7.1 · Pleroma / pleroma · GitLab
        Pleroma backend

Feeds

  • Activity Streams
  • RSS 2.0
  • Atom
  • Help
  • About
  • FAQ
  • TOS
  • Privacy
  • Source
  • Version
  • Contact

GNU social JP is a social network, courtesy of GNU social JP管理人. It runs on GNU social, version 2.0.2-dev, available under the GNU Affero General Public License.

Creative Commons Attribution 3.0 All GNU social JP content and data are available under the Creative Commons Attribution 3.0 license.